Wave's configuration files are located at ~/.config/waveterm/.
The main configuration file is settings.json (~/.config/waveterm/settings.json).
The file is structured as a mostly flat JSON file. Instead of using sub-objects we prefer to use ":" as level separators.

| Key Name | Type | Function |
|---|---|---|
| app:globalhotkey | string | A systemwide keybinding to open your most recent wave window. This is a set of key names separated by :. For more info, see Customizable Systemwide Global Hotkey |
| app:dismissarchitecturewarning | bool | Disable warnings on app start when you are using a non-native architecture for Wave. For more info, see Why does Wave warn me about ARM64 translation when it launches?. |
| app:defaultnewblock | string | Sets the default new block (Cmd:n, Cmd:d). "term" for terminal block, "launcher" for launcher block (default = "term") |
| app:showoverlayblocknums | bool | Set to false to disable the Ctrl+Shift block number overlay that appears when holding Ctrl+Shift (defaults to true) |
| app:ctrlvpaste | bool | On Windows/Linux, when null (default) uses Control+V on Windows only. Set to true to force Control+V on all non-macOS platforms, false to disable the accelerator. macOS always uses Command+V regardless of this setting |
| app:confirmquit | bool | Set to false to disable the quit confirmation dialog when closing Wave Terminal (defaults to true, requires app restart) |
| app:hideaibutton | bool | Set to true to hide the AI button in the tab bar (defaults to false) |
| app:disablectrlshiftarrows | bool | Set to true to disable Ctrl+Shift block-navigation keybindings (Arrow and h/j/k/l) (defaults to false) |
| app:disablectrlshiftdisplay | bool | Set to true to disable the Ctrl+Shift visual indicator display (defaults to false) |
| app:focusfollowscursor | string | Controls whether block focus follows cursor movement: "off" (default), "on" (all blocks), or "term" (terminal blocks only) |
| app:tabbar | string | Controls the position of the tab bar: "top" (default) for a horizontal tab bar at the top of the window, or "left" for a vertical tab bar on the left side of the window |
| ai:preset | string | the default AI preset to use |
| ai:baseurl | string | Set the AI Base Url (must be OpenAI compatible) |
| ai:apitoken | string | your AI api token |
| ai:apitype | string | defaults to "open_ai", but can also set to "azure" (forspecial Azure AI handling), "anthropic", or "perplexity" |
| ai:name | string | string to display in the Wave AI block header |
| ai:model | string | model name to pass to API |
| ai:apiversion | string | for Azure AI only (when apitype is "azure", this will default to "2023-05-15") |
| ai:orgid | string | |
| ai:maxtokens | int | max tokens to pass to API |
| ai:timeoutms | int | timeout (in milliseconds) for AI calls |
| ai:proxyurl | string | HTTP proxy URL for AI API requests (does not apply to Wave Cloud AI) |
| conn:askbeforewshinstall | bool | set to false to disable popup asking if you want to install wsh extensions on new machines |
| conn:localhostdisplayname | string | override the display name for localhost in the UI (e.g., set to "My Laptop" or "Local", or set to empty string to hide the name) |
| term:fontsize | float | the fontsize for the terminal block |
| term:fontfamily | string | font family to use for terminal block |
| term:disablewebgl | bool | set to false to disable WebGL acceleration in terminal |
| term:localshellpath | string | set to override the default shell path for local terminals |
| term:localshellopts | string[] | set to pass additional parameters to the term:localshellpath (example: ["-NoLogo"] for PowerShell will remove the copyright notice) |
| term:copyonselect | bool | set to false to disable terminal copy-on-select |
| term:scrollback | int | size of terminal scrollback buffer, max is 10000 |
| term:theme | string | preset name of terminal theme to apply by default (default is "default-dark") |
| term:transparency | float64 | set the background transparency of terminal theme (default 0.5, 0 = not transparent, 1.0 = fully transparent) |
| term:allowbracketedpaste | bool | allow bracketed paste mode in terminal (default false) |
| term:shiftenternewline | bool | when enabled, Shift+Enter sends escape sequence + newline (\u001b\n) instead of carriage return, useful for claude code and similar AI coding tools (default false) |
| term:macoptionismeta | bool | on macOS, treat the Option key as Meta key for terminal keybindings (default false) |
| term:cursor | string | terminal cursor style. valid values are block (default), underline, and bar |
| term:cursorblink | bool | when enabled, terminal cursor blinks (default false) |
| term:bellsound | bool | when enabled, plays the system beep sound when the terminal bell (BEL character) is received (default false) |
| term:bellindicator | bool | when enabled, shows a visual indicator in the tab when the terminal bell is received (default false) |
| term:osc52 | string | controls OSC 52 clipboard behavior: always (default, allows OSC 52 at any time) or focus (requires focused window and focused block) |
| term:durable | bool | makes remote terminal sessions durable across network disconnects (defaults to false) |
| term:showsplitbuttons | bool | when enabled, shows split horizontal and vertical buttons in the terminal block header (defaults to false) |
| editor:minimapenabled | bool | set to false to disable editor minimap |
| editor:stickyscrollenabled | bool | enables monaco editor's stickyScroll feature (pinning headers of current context, e.g. class names, method names, etc.), defaults to false |
| editor:wordwrap | bool | set to true to enable word wrapping in the editor (defaults to false) |
| editor:fontsize | float64 | set the font size for the editor (defaults to 12px) |
| editor:inlinediff | bool | set to true to show diffs inline instead of side-by-side, false for side-by-side (defaults to undefined which uses Monaco's responsive behavior) |
| preview:showhiddenfiles | bool | set to false to disable showing hidden files in the directory preview (defaults to true) |
| preview:defaultsort | string | sets the default sort column for directory preview. "name" (default) sorts alphabetically by name ascending; "modtime" sorts by last modified time descending (newest first) |
| markdown:fontsize | float64 | font size for the normal text when rendering markdown in preview. headers are scaled up from this size, (default 14px) |
| markdown:fixedfontsize | float64 | font size for the code blocks when rendering markdown in preview (default is 12px) |
| web:openlinksinternally | bool | set to false to open web links in external browser |
| web:defaulturl | string | default web page to open in the web widget when no url is provided (homepage) |
| web:defaultsearch | string | search template for web searches. e.g. https://www.google.com/search?q={query}. "{query}" gets replaced by search term |
| autoupdate:enabled | bool | enable/disable checking for updates (requires app restart) |
| autoupdate:intervalms | float64 | time in milliseconds to wait between update checks (requires app restart) |
| autoupdate:installonquit | bool | whether to automatically install updates on quit (requires app restart) |
| autoupdate:channel | string | the auto update channel "latest" (stable builds), or "beta" (updated more frequently) (requires app restart) |
| tab:preset | string | a "bg@" preset to automatically apply to new tabs. e.g. bg@green. should match the preset key. deprecated in favor of tab:background |
| tab:background | string | a "bg@" preset to automatically apply to new tabs. e.g. bg@green. should match the preset key |
| tab:confirmclose | bool | if set to true, a confirmation dialog will be shown before closing a tab (defaults to false) |
| widget:showhelp | bool | whether to show help/tips widgets in right sidebar |
| window:transparent | bool | set to true to enable window transparency (cannot be combined with window:blur) (macOS and Windows only, requires app restart, see note on Windows compatibility) |
| window:blur | bool | set to enable window background blurring (cannot be combined with window:transparent) (macOS and Windows only, requires app restart, see note on Windows compatibility) |
| window:opacity | float64 | 0-1, window opacity when window:transparent or window:blur are set |
| window:bgcolor | string | set the window background color (should be hex: #xxxxxx) |
| window:reducedmotion | bool | set to true to disable most animations |
| window:tilegapsize | int | set to change override default gap size (in CSS pixels) between blocks |
| window:magnifiedblockopacity | float64 | change the opacity of a magnified block (must be between 0 and 1, defaults to 0.6) |
| window:magnifiedblocksize | float64 | change the size of a magnified block as a percentage of the dimensions of its parent layout (must be between 0 and 1, defaults to 0.9) |
| window:magnifiedblockblurprimarypx | int | change the blur in CSS pixels that is applied directly behind a magnified block (see backdrop-filter for more info on how this gets applied) |
| window:magnifiedblockblursecondarypx | int | change the blur in CSS pixels that is applied to the visible portions of non-magnified blocks when a block is magnified (see backdrop-filter for more info on how this gets applied) |
| window:maxtabcachesize | int | number of tabs to cache. when tabs are cached, switching between them is very fast. (defaults to 10) |
| window:showmenubar | bool | set to use the OS-native menu bar (Windows and Linux only, requires app restart) |
| window:nativetitlebar | bool | set to use the OS-native title bar, rather than the overlay (Windows and Linux only, requires app restart) |
| window:disablehardwareacceleration | bool | set to disable Chromium hardware acceleration to resolve graphical bugs (requires app restart) |
| window:fullscreenonlaunch | bool | set to true to launch the foreground window in fullscreen mode (defaults to false) |
| window:savelastwindow | bool | when true, the last window that is closed is preserved and is reopened the next time the app is launched (defaults to true) |
| window:confirmonclose | bool | when true, a prompt will ask a user to confirm that they want to close a window if it has an unsaved workspace with more than one tab (defaults to true) |
| window:dimensions | string | set the default dimensions for new windows using the format "WIDTHxHEIGHT" (e.g. "1920x1080"). when a new window is created, these dimensions will be automatically applied. The width and height values should be specified in pixels. |
| telemetry:enabled | bool | set to enable/disable telemetry |

If you installed Wave pre-v0.9.0 your configuration file will be located at
~/.waveterm/config/settings.json. This includes all of the other configuration
files as well: termthemes.json, presets.json, and widgets.json.

To avoid putting secrets directly in config files, Wave supports environment variable resolution using $ENV:VARIABLE_NAME or $ENV:VARIABLE_NAME:fallback syntax. This works for any string value in any config file (settings.json, presets.json, ai.json, etc.).
{
"ai:apitoken": "$ENV:OPENAI_APIKEY",
"ai:baseurl": "$ENV:AI_BASEURL:https://api.openai.com/v1"

User-defined terminal themes are located in ~/.config/waveterm/termthemes.json.
This JSON file is structured as an object, with each sub-key defining a theme.
Themes are applied by right-clicking on the terminal's header bar and selecting an entry from the "Themes" sub-menu. Alternatively they can be applied to
the block's metadata key term:theme. This uses the JSON key value as the identifier. Note, for best consistency all colors should be of the format "#rrggbb" or "#rrggbbaa" (aa = alpha channel for transparency).
wsh setmeta this term:theme="default-dark"
Here is an example of defining a full terminal theme. All of the built-in themes are defined here: https://github.com/wavetermdev/waveterm/blob/main/pkg/wconfig/defaultconfig/termthemes.json (if you'd like to add a popular terminal theme, please submit a PR!)

| Key Name | Type | ANSI FG# | ANSI BG# | Function |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| display:name | string | the name as it will appear in the UI context menu | ||
| display:order | float | entries in the context menu are sorted by display:order | ||
| black | CSS color | 30 | 40 | color for black |
| red | CSS color | 31 | 41 | color for red |
| green | CSS color | 32 | 42 | color for green |
| yellow | CSS color | 33 | 43 | color for yellow |
| blue | CSS color | 34 | 44 | color for blue |
| magenta | CSS color | 35 | 45 | color for magenta |
| cyan | CSS color | 36 | 46 | color for cyan |
| white | CSS color | 37 | 47 | color for white |
| brightBlack | CSS color | 90 | 100 | color for bright black |
| brightRed | CSS color | 91 | 101 | color for bright red |
| brightGreen | CSS color | 92 | 102 | color for bright green |
| brightYellow | CSS color | 93 | 103 | color for bright yellow |
| brightBlue | CSS color | 94 | 104 | color for bright blue |
| brightMagenta | CSS color | 95 | 105 | color for bright magenta |
| brightCyan | CSS color | 96 | 106 | color for bright cyan |
| brightWhite | CSS color | 97 | 107 | color for bright white |
| gray | CSS color | currently unused | ||
| cmdtext | CSS color | currently unused | ||
| foreground | CSS color | foreground color (default when no color code is applied) | ||
| background | CSS color | background color (default when no color code is applied), must have alpha channel (#rrggbbaa) if you want the terminal to be transparent | ||
| cursorAccent | CSS color | color for cursor | ||
| selectionBackground | CSS color | background color for selected text |
Wave allows settings a custom global hotkey to open your most recent window from anywhere in your computer. This has the name "app:globalhotkey" in the settings.json file and takes the form of a series of key names separated by the : character.
As a practical example, suppose you want a value of F5 as your global hotkey. Then you can simply set the value of "app:globalhotkey" to "F5" and reboot Wave to make that your global hotkey.
As a less practical example, suppose you use the combination of the keys Ctrl, Option, and e. Then the value for this keybinding would be "Ctrl:Option:e".
We support the following key names:
